I love odd things. Here's my crazy random charm quilt.

Instead of sewing two charm pieces together and then cutting (giving you two squares the same), I decided to go completely random and cut all 42 charms first, then sewing triangles together randomly, so no two squares were the same. I love the outcome.

It's not finished yet. We're off to the big smoke on the weekend, and I simply must go to Spotlight to find some matching fabric for a border and backing. Ha! And not just for this one quilt lol

A post from Wendy (it has been awhile I know) Had the most amazing day on Friday. I went to my art journal class and we started talking about new projects to try. So on a whim we came back later that night to play with some acrylics and silicone.

I'm a big fan of Leslie Ohnstad works and have been following her on YouTube under ColourArte. I did three canvases following her instructions with fluid acrylic and silicone. Was amazed by the way cells continued to form until the paint was dry. (I had to message her to say a big thank you for sharing her classes).

I'm glad no one was filming us, as one of my friends and I were jumping around and giggling as we watched the images developing before our eyes. I was exhausted and very stiff that night but my heart was full of fire. Mentally it was just what the doctor ordered.

Ooopsie. As the saying goes "measure twice, cut once". However, there is also a saying that goes something like "there are no mistakes in art".

I cut my disappearing nine patch incorrectly but I like the outcome. On the second cut, instead of cutting 2 1/4 in (half way), I cut at 1 1/4".

Turned this patch into a little minkie blankie.
